Raw Pink Granite Specimen
Set of 12 Samples, 1"

Commonly found as magmatic intrusions in the crust, granite forms slowly in shallow or evolved magma chambers. The large crystals are indicative of a slow cooling rate, and make mineral identification simple. Ideal for teaching students about rounding and sorting, as well as for identification & classification exercises. This classic igneous rock is a must-have sample when discussing rock types, the rock cycle, and the rock formation.
